We are searching for an exceptional Hardware (+ Embedded) Engineer who can design and master high-speed PCBs (sub-1 GHz domains) and navigate embedded systems with confidence and precision. This role demands flawless execution, deep technical discipline and the drive to build hardware that simply cannot fail. * Design high-speed PCBs (sub-1 GHz) including signal-integrity-sensitive traces, controlled impedance, differential pairs and clean power distribution
* Develop and integrate embedded hardware modules (MCUs, sensors, cameras, power systems, interfaces)
* Own the entire hardware lifecycle from schematic → layout → bring-up → testing → validation → revision
* Perform board bring-up using o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, JTAG/SWD and low-level debugging
* Optimize system reliability and noise immunity in mixed-signal environments
* Work closely with firmware/embedded engineers to align hardware–software boundaries and debug edge cases
* Create rigorous documentation (BOMs, test records, hardware notes, revision logs)
* Collaborate on manufacturing processes (DFM/DFT), component selection, and vendor communication
* Prototype rapidly and iterate under pressure with tight timelines
* Deep experience in high-speed PCB design (sub-1 GHz signalling, impedance control, return-path mastery)
* Proficiency with professional PCB tools (Altium)
* Solid understanding of embedded systems (MCUs, RTOS basics, bootloaders, interface protocols)
* Hands-on debugging skills with o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, multimeters and bench equipment
* Knowledge of EMI/EMC fundamentals and how to avoid SI/PI pitfalls
* Experience with common interfaces (I²C, SPI, UART, CSI, USB, HDMI/DP basics, power rails)
* Ability to read, interpret, and implement high-speed application notes and reference designs
* Strong understanding of power electronics fundamentals (DC-DC converters, power budgeting, noise reduction)
* Experience bringing hardware from prototype to production (DFM, sourcing, production testing)
